Aspirated Consonants: ㅋ ㅌ ㅍ ㅊ
Hear and produce the aspirated consonants ㅋ, ㅌ, ㅍ, ㅊ, and tell them apart from their plain partners ㄱ, ㄷ, ㅂ, ㅈ by the puff of air.
A puff of air changes everything
ㅋ, ㅌ, ㅍ, and ㅊ are the aspirated partners of ㄱ, ㄷ, ㅂ, and ㅈ — same mouth position, but with a strong burst of air released. Hold a piece of paper (or your hand) an inch in front of your mouth: say 가 and the paper barely moves, then say 카 and it should flutter. English already has this contrast — compare the 'p' in spin (no puff) to the 'p' in pin (puff) — Korean just gives each version its own letter. Each aspirated letter is written as its plain partner plus one extra stroke, a visual reminder of the extra breath.
